Description
This volume presents the revised lecture notes of selected talks given at the 6th Central European Functional Programming School, CEFP 2015, held in July 2015, in Budapest, Hungary.
The 10 revised full papers presented were carefully reviewed and selected. The lectures covered a wide range of functional programming and C++ programming subjects.

Content
Watch out for that tree! A Tutorial on Shortcut Deforestation.- Functional Reactive Programming in C++.- Immutables in C++: Language Foundation for Functional Programming.- Programming in a Functional Style in C++.- Functional, Reactive Web Programming in F#.- Functional Languages in Design of Colored Petri Nets Models.- Single Assignment C (SAC): The Compilation Technology Perspective.- Type-Safe Functions and Tasks in a Shallow Embedded DSL for Microprocessors.- Static and Dynamic Visualizations of Monadic Programs.- Analyzing Scale-free Properties in Erlang and Scala.
